Importance of Exfoliation
Types of exfoliants: physical vs. chemical. Recommended frequency and techniques for effective exfoliation.Exfoliation is like giving your skin a refreshing wake-up call! It helps remove dead skin cells, making way for new ones. There are two types of exfoliants: physical and chemical. Physical exfoliants, like scrubs, use tiny particles to scrub your skin. Chemical exfoliants use acids to dissolve dead cells. Aim to exfoliate once or twice a week for glowing skin. Remember, too much can be like overcooking a pizza—nobody wants that!
Type of Exfoliant | Description | Recommended Frequency |
---|---|---|
Physical | Scrubs and brushes. | 1-2 times a week |
Chemical | Alpha and beta hydroxy acids. | 2-3 times a week |

Monthly Skin Treatments and Facials
Professional treatments: chemical peels, microdermabrasion, and facials. How to incorporate these treatments into your routine.Think of your skin as a canvas, and monthly treatments are like the artists’ brush! Professional options like chemical peels and microdermabrasion can work wonders. These treatments help shed dead skin and reveal a glowing surface. Facials? They’re like a mini vacation for your face. Plan to get one each month. Here’s a simple chart to keep track:
Treatment | Frequency | Benefits |
---|---|---|
Chemical Peel | Every 4-6 weeks | Brightens skin, evens tone |
Microdermabrasion | Once a month | Removes surface dead skin |
Facial | Once a month | Relaxation, hydration |

Adapting Your Routine for Seasonal Changes
How weather affects skin and routine adjustments needed. Tips for maintaining skin health in different climates.Weather can change how our skin looks and feels. In winter, the air gets dry. This can make your skin feel tight and flaky. In summer, heat and humidity can cause oily skin and breakouts. Adjusting your routine helps keep your skin healthy. Here are some tips:
- Use a thicker moisturizer in cold weather.
- Switch to lighter products in warm months.
- Apply sunscreen every day, no matter the season.
- Hydrate by drinking plenty of water.
By changing your products as the seasons change, you can keep your skin glowing and fresh all year round.
How does weather affect skin health?
Weather affects skin health by changing moisture levels and oil production. For example, hot weather can cause excess oil, while cold weather may lead to dryness. Adjusting skincare products helps maintain balance.
